With the backing of the Trump administration's "AI First" directive, Musk aims to modernize the federal workflow significantly. His program, spearheaded by the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E), includes the development of a customized AI system named "GSAi" intended for use by the U.S. General Services Administration (GSA). This strategic move seeks to enhance the productivity of GSA's 12,000 employees by automating several duties traditionally performed by human staff.
The GSA's role entails managing federal office infrastructure, contracts, and IT systems, making it a pivotal player in the federal landscape. Musk’s ambition is to utilize GSAi for efficient analytical processing of contracts and procurement data. Within this context, the
and Musk's team bypassed the initial consideration of Google's AI model "Gemini," opting instead for a proprietary AI solution tailored to their specific requirements.However, Musk's assertive methodology has stirred both anticipation and critique. While AI tools promise efficiency gains, there are inherent risks when decision-making processes are wholly entrusted to AI outputs. Concerns arise from AI's limitations in replicating nuanced human judgment, evidenced by recent missteps such as Google's AI providing erroneous information during public demonstrations. Despite such instances, Musk remains a staunch advocate for harnessing AI capabilities to streamline governance.
This drive to transform government operations comes amidst broader Trump administration efforts to leverage AI technology not just for efficiency but as a transformative instrument for federal agency operations. Although facing skepticism and resistance, particularly from unions and political adversaries, there is momentum in the realignment towards AI-augmented governance frameworks, as technology becomes pivotal to reigning in federal expenditure and adapting bureaucratic structures to future imperatives.
